World of Warcraft has opened signups for Mists of Pandaria Classic

    
2

No, you haven’t just wandered through a dodgy portal: Blizzard is pushing the World of Warcraft Classic progression servers on to Mists of Pandaria this year, and if you wanted to peep it early, the beta is your ticket.

“Return to the mystic lands of Pandaria – a world shrouded in fog and mystery,” Blizzard commands you. “This ancient realm, untouched by time and war, is returning in World of Warcraft: Mists of Pandaria Classic* with a renewed sense of wonder and adventure, inviting you to lose yourself again in its lush forests, cloud-ringed mountains, and timeless secrets. Home to the enigmatic Pandaren and the stalwart Monks – Pandaria has reemerged into a world on the brink of war, just as the forces of the Alliance and Horde draw closer to a conflict threatening to consume all.”

That little asterisk reminds players that the launch is set for “on or before” August 31st – and of course, you need a WoW sub to access it. Signups are conducted through the “beta opt-in” button on Battlenet. There’s no date for when the testing itself begins.

If you’ve forgotten everything about this expansion except the obvious Pandaren themselves, MOP’s Eliot did a revisit a few years ago – and you may be surprised to find out that the content and mechanics actually hold up pretty well.
